Is it Real?

The $3,600 One Time CTC Payment is not real; it is a tax credit, not a one-time lump sum. The CTC is claimed on your annual tax return. For 2024, the maximum CTC is $3,600 per child under six and $3,000 per child aged 6-17.

$3,600 CTC Eligibility

To qualify for the $3,600 One Time CTC Payment, you generally need to meet the following criteria:

  • You must be a US citizen or resident alien.
  • You must have a qualifying child under 18 at the end of the tax year.
  • The child must be your pendant.
  • The child must have a proper Social Security Number.
  • You must deliver more than half of the child’s support.
  • The child must have lived with you for better than half the year.

These are some general eligibility standards, and your earnings will determine the amount of credit you can argue. There are income phase-outs.

$3,600 One Time Deposit Date

Traditionally, the CTC is claimed on your annual tax return. You receive a refund if the credit exceeds your tax liability. However, the American Rescue Plan temporarily introduced advance CTC payments, which were distributed monthly. These monthly payments were discontinued after Dec 2021.

Therefore, the CTC Payment does not have any specific payment dates; you can claim it annually. However, this whole amount will not be offered as a one-time deposit.

$3,600 One Time CTC Payment Latest News

While there has been significant interest and support for expanding the CTC, as of now, there are no concrete plans for a $3,600 one-time payment. It’s essential to stay informed about any potential changes in tax laws and regulations.

The confusion might stem from the temporary expansion of the CTC in 2021 under the American Rescue Plan, which retained monthly advance payments. However, these payments ended in Dec 2021.
